Humans have not even resemble defining a global coding standard that everyone concurs with. Even the most extensively agreed upon concepts like SOLID are still a resource for conversation as to just how deeply it have to be carried out. For all sensible objectives, it's imposible to flawlessly follow SOLID unless you have no monetary (or time) restraint whatsoever; which just isn't possible in the economic sector where most advancement occurs.



In lack of an objective measure of right and wrong, how are we mosting likely to be able to offer a device positive/negative responses to make it find out? At ideal, we can have several people offer their own opinion to the maker ("this is good/bad code"), and the device's outcome will then be an "typical point of view".

For debugging in particular, it's important to recognize that particular developers are susceptible to presenting a particular type of bug/mistake. As I am frequently involved in bugfixing others' code at work, I have a kind of assumption of what kind of error each programmer is vulnerable to make.

Based on the developer, I might look in the direction of the config file or the LINQ. Likewise, I've functioned at a number of business as a professional currently, and I can clearly see that types of bugs can be prejudiced towards particular kinds of business. It's not a hard and quick guideline that I can effectively mention, but there is a certain pattern.

The Of Advanced Machine Learning Course



Like I claimed before, anything a human can find out, a machine can as well. Nevertheless, just how do you recognize that you've taught the equipment the complete variety of opportunities? Just how can you ever before supply it with a little (i.e. not international) dataset and know for sure that it stands for the full spectrum of bugs? Or, would you rather create certain debuggers to assist specific developers/companies, instead than develop a debugger that is widely usable? Requesting for a machine-learned debugger resembles requesting a machine-learned Sherlock Holmes.
